随着计算机图形学(Computer Graphics,简称CG)的快速发展,CG语言函数作为一种核心技术,已经广泛应用于电影、游戏、广告、建筑等多个领域。本文将从CG语言函数的定义、特点、应用以及发展趋势等方面进行探讨,旨在为广大读者揭示这一技术在创意与技术的完美融合中所发挥的重要作用。
一、CG语言函数概述
1. 定义
CG语言函数是计算机图形学中的一种编程语言,主要用于实现图形绘制、动画制作、虚拟现实等任务。它通过调用各种函数,将数学模型转化为可视化的图形,从而实现创意与技术的完美融合。
2. 特点
(1)高效性:CG语言函数具有高效的执行速度,能够快速生成高质量的图形效果。
(2)可扩展性:CG语言函数具有较强的可扩展性,能够根据实际需求进行调整和优化。
(3)跨平台性:CG语言函数支持多种操作系统和硬件平台,具有广泛的适用范围。
(4)易于学习:CG语言函数具有较高的易学性,便于用户掌握和使用。
二、CG语言函数应用领域
1. 电影制作
在电影制作领域,CG语言函数被广泛应用于场景渲染、角色动画、特效制作等方面。例如,在《阿凡达》等影片中,CG语言函数为观众呈现了一个充满奇幻色彩的虚拟世界。
2. 游戏开发
游戏开发领域,CG语言函数主要用于角色建模、场景渲染、物理效果等方面。通过运用CG语言函数,游戏开发者可以创造出丰富多彩的游戏世界,为玩家带来沉浸式体验。
3. 广告宣传
在广告宣传领域,CG语言函数可以制作出极具视觉冲击力的动画效果,为广告作品增色添彩。例如,许多汽车广告都采用了CG语言函数制作的动画,以展示汽车的性能和特点。
4. 建筑可视化
在建筑可视化领域,CG语言函数可以用于制作建筑效果图、室内设计效果图等。通过运用CG语言函数,设计师可以直观地展示设计方案,为客户带来更具说服力的展示效果。
三、CG语言函数发展趋势
1. 软硬件协同发展
随着硬件设备的不断提升,CG语言函数将更加注重与硬件的协同发展,以实现更高的性能和更优的视觉效果。
2. 技术融合与创新
CG语言函数将与其他领域的技术进行融合,如人工智能、虚拟现实等,以创造更多创新性的应用场景。
3. 个性化定制
未来,CG语言函数将更加注重个性化定制,以满足不同用户的需求。
CG语言函数作为计算机图形学中的核心技术,为创意与技术的融合提供了有力支持。随着技术的不断发展,CG语言函数将在更多领域发挥重要作用,为我们的生活带来更多精彩。